Plausibility fault in the
speed recording
The difference between the two
speed sensors is higher than
the configured speed switch-off
threshold.
• Check track again with the
set data in the encoder con-
figuration.
• Check speed sensor.
• Use the SCOPE function to
set speed signals so that
they are congruent.

Plausibility fault in the pos-
ition detection.
The difference between the two
position signals is higher than
the configured increment
switch-off threshold.
• Check track with the con-
figured data of the encoder
setting.
• Check position signal.
• Are all signals connected
correctly to the 9-pin en-
coder connector?
• Check encoder connector
for correct connection.
• Use the SCOPE function to
set positions signals so that
they are congruent.

Plausibility fault incorrect
position range.
The current position is outside
the configured measurement
range.
• Check track with the con-
figured data of the encoder
setting.
• Check position signal, cor-
rect offset if necessary.
• Use the SCOPE function to
set positions signals so that
they are congruent.
139
140
Plausibility fault incorrect
speed.
The current speed exceeds the
configured maximum speed.
• The drive moves outside
the permitted and con-
figured speed range.
• Check the configuration
(encoder screen: max. set
speed).
• Analyze the speed profile
using the SCOPE function.
141
142
Plausibility fault incorrect
acceleration.
The current acceleration is out-
side the configured accelera-
tion range. The drive has ex-
ceeded the permitted accelera-
tion range
• Check the configuration
(encoder screen: max. set
speed).
• Analyze the speed/acceler-
ation profile using the
SCOPE function.
